A random sample of 500 army recruits has a mean height of 68 inches with a standard deviation of 2.5 inches. if a 95% confidence

interval is constructed, with all conditions having been met, what is the margin of error?
A) 68
B) 6.02
C) .22
D) .184

Answer:

c) 0.22

Step-by-step explanation:

<u>Explanation</u>:-

A random sample of 500 army recruits has a mean height of 68 inches with a standard deviation of 2.5 inches.

The sample size 'n' = 500

Given the mean of the sample = 68 inches

Given standard deviation = 2.5 inches

 Margin error   = \frac{Z_{\alpha } S.D}{\sqrt{n} }

The 95% of confidence interval ∝ = 1.96

M.E = \frac{1.96 X 2.5}{\sqrt{500} }

Margin of error = 0.2191 ≅0.22

<u>Conclusion</u>:-

The Margin of error at 95% of confidence intervals = 0.22
